Why is x^2+9 not able to be factored?

The expression x^2 + 9 is an algebraic expression

x^2 + 9 cannot be factored because it is not a difference of two squares

How to determine why the expression cannot be factored?

The expression is given as:

x^2 + 9

Express 9 as the square of 3

x^2 + 3^2

The above expression is not a difference of two squares

Hence, x^2 + 9 cannot be factored because it is not a difference of two squares
